I ran into the upcoming RD600 motherboard preview @tweaktown.com, and found the following tidbit.
Intel has recently teamed up with nVidia (or visa-versa) to allow users to officially run SLI dual graphics on Intel 975X based motherboards which might be a result of the internals testing?s of the RD600 platform or maybe purely just a reaction to AMD and ATI?s news. Nevertheless, things are starting to heat up and it?s a good time to be a consumer.
http://www.tweaktown.com/articles/931/5/page_5_final_thoughts/index.html

Is this true? If so, it's a great news since the NForce500 series' FSB overclocking is rumoured to be inferior to that of P965/975X. SLI users wouldn't be forced to choose NForce board.

Originally posted by: dexvx
I find it highly ironic that Quadro's can run SLI on 975 chipsets but regular 7800/7900's aren't good enough to.

All the SLI/Crossfire incompatibilities are just driver lockouts. Of course Nvidia doesn't want to lock out its highest margin market.
